Commercial Description:
Duckwheat Hefeweizen: Dark straw yellow in color with amber hues, this Pacific Northwest version of a classic German-style wheat beer is the perfect introduction to microbrewed beer. Lightly hopped with imported Czech Saaz, German Tettnanger and Hersbrucker hops, the clean brew starts light on the palate and is both thirst quenching and refreshing

Medium gold color. Medium head. Aroma is malty and slightly sweet. A medium bodied hefeweizen. Malts are fruity and slightly sweet. Hops are slightly spicy and mild. Not your typical hefe, it has a lot of hop bite to it and not much of the banana and clove flavor. Nice balance. Smooth flavor. Mouthfeel is full and round. Finish is slightly bitter.
